Analysis

The most recent figure for meat consumption vs gdp per capita in India is 8.12,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 63 years on record.

That represents a change of up 2.1% on the previous year and up 110.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, meat consumption vs gdp per capita in India peaked at 8.12 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 3.65, in 1977.

That places India 181st out of 191 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 3.73 3.69 3.8 9
1970s 3.67 3.65 3.7 10
1980s 3.99 3.74 4.16 10
1990s 4.11 3.99 4.24 10
2000s 4.09 3.91 4.32 10
2010s 4.41 3.85 5.17 10
2020s 7.19 6.19 8.12 4
